HERE is Sunday's latest breakdown, area-by-area, of positive cases of COVID-19 in Bradford.

There are 667 confirmed cases in today's figures, up 24 from yesterday and a 91 per cent increase from seven days ago.

The area with the highest number of cases is Fairweather Green with 29, followed by Bowling Park with 27 cases and Undercliffe withh 26.

Fewer than three cases were only recorded in Keighley South, Oakworth & Laycock and Thornbury, so they are not included in today's list to protect the identities of patients. 

In the neighbouring areas lists, a handful of areas continue to have fewer than three cases so are not included in today's list to protect the identities of patients.

The data is provided by Public Health England and looks at cases by 'Middle Super Output Area (MSOA)' - a type of statistical unit used in the reporting of small area statistics.

It provides figures for areas which have had three or more positive cases, so some areas not listed below may have had positive cases, but less than three.

The data includes lab confirmed positive cases of Covid-19, with specimen dates in the seven days up to June 8.

MSOAs are a standard statistical geography of approximately 7,200 people. Some MSOAs have the same name as local electoral wards and figures within the map should not be compared with ward data.
